IP13 vs IP16
Head-to-head comparison of two IEC 60529 ingress protection ratings.
IP13 and IP16 are both IEC 60529 ingress protection codes, but they differ in liquid protection (level 3 vs 6). IP13 is rated for > 50 mm — back of hand and spraying water (up to 60°), while IP16 provides > 50 mm — back of hand and powerful water jets (12.5 mm nozzle).
The IP13 rating offers protection against solid objects larger than 50 mm and protection against spraying water. Water sprayed at an angle up to 60° on either side of the vertical shall have no harmful effects.. It is an IEC 60529 ingress protection code combining first-digit (solid) level 1 with second-digit (liquid) level 3.
IP16 is an ingress protection code that ensures protection against solid objects larger than 50 mm and protection against powerful water jets. Water projected in powerful jets by a 12.5 mm nozzle against the enclosure from any direction shall have no harmful effects.. It is an IEC 60529 ingress protection code combining first-digit (solid) level 1 with second-digit (liquid) level 6.

The exact difference (IP13 vs IP16)
Solid protection
IP13
Level 1 — > 50 mm — Back of Hand
IP16
Level 1 — > 50 mm — Back of Hand
Both IP13 and IP16 share the same solid protection: > 50 mm — Back of Hand.
Liquid protection
IP13
Level 3 — Spraying Water (up to 60°)
IP16
Level 6 — Powerful Water Jets (12.5 mm nozzle)
IP13 handles 80 kPa (tube) / 50 kPa (nozzle) (Spraying Water (up to 60°)), while IP16 handles 100 kPa (Powerful Water Jets (12.5 mm nozzle)). IP16 provides 3 levels more liquid protection.
